Mad Hatter Dance Off – The Royal Ballet vs ZooNation



 

Royal Ballet Principal Steven McRae and ZooNation's Turbo compete in a ballet/tap vs hip-hop dance

Two
Mad Hatters take to the stages of the Royal Opera House this festive
season, in works inspired by Lewis Carroll’s Alice’s Adventures in
Wonderland. We couldn’t resist bringing together the two different
versions of the same character for a dance-off in full costume in front
of an audience of 50 excited children from local school St Joseph’s
Primary.

Royal Ballet Principal Steven McRae plays the
tap-dancing Mad Hatter in The Royal Ballet’s Alice’s Adventures in
Wonderland this Christmas, while Turbo’s hip hop-styled Mad Hatter
features in ZooNation’s Mad Hatter’s Tea Party. The former production
will be live in cinemas around the world on 16 December, while the
latter will be live-streamed for free via YouTube and this website on 18
December.
